Question
what units are used to measure mass and weight?
○ mass and weight are measured in kilograms.
○ mass and weight are measured in newtons.
○ mass is measured in kilograms, and weight is measured in newtons.
○ mass is measured in newtons, and weight is measured in kilograms.
Brief Explanations
Mass is an intrinsic property of matter, measured in kilograms (the SI base unit for mass). Weight is a force (the force of gravity on an object), so it follows the SI unit for force, which is newtons.
